Staff Full Stack Engineer

Location: Richmond, VA, McLean, VA, or Jersey City Area, NJ

Work Environment: Hybrid

 

Role Summary:

We are seeking a highly experienced Staff Full Stack Engineer to lead the architecture, development, and scaling of our next-generation, cloud-based platforms. This role is ideal for a senior technical leader who thrives in both hands-on engineering and strategic influence. You’ll own key architectural decisions, guide engineering best practices, mentor teams, and drive major multi-team initiatives that shape the future of our technology organization.

What You’ll Do:

  • 60% coding, 20% design, 20% leadership and influence
  • Lead architectural strategy across teams and set long-term technical direction
  • Unblock engineering teams and design scalable, high-performance solutions
  • Drive major cross-team initiatives aligned with product and business priorities
  • Make high-impact architectural and technical decisions
  • Promote a culture of learning, ownership, and technical excellence
  • Contribute to planning, budgeting, and understanding financial drivers

What You Need:

  • 8+ years developing with JavaScript/TypeScript and one OO language (Java, Go, C/C++, C#, Python, etc.)
  • 6+ years architecting and delivering Micro Frontends or similarly complex cloud-based systems (AWS, GCP, Azure)
  • Experience with WebGL, D3.js, or SVG visualizations
  • Experience with modern UI libraries (e.g., Angular Material)
  • Hands-on experience with Terraform and AWS or other IaC/cloud environments
  • Deep understanding of Data Structures, Algorithms, frontend best practices, UI/UX, design systems, accessibility, and responsive design
  • Strong background in Agile/Scrum and optimizing global, enterprise-scale software
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ills
  • Familiarity with SOAP, REST, XML, JSON, HTML, GraphQL, RPC
